Retail activation with the All Blacks in France

For the 2023 Rugby World Cup in France, we brought the legendary All Blacks together with our partner O’Rugby in Toulouse. 150 invited fans had the exclusive opportunity to preview the latest adidas rugby collection and attend an in-store talk with the players. The event featured signing sessions, photo opportunities, and a high-stakes giveaway.
To amplify the reach, we collaborated with rugby content creator Nogodi (130k+ followers), who produced specialized content featuring the players. The focus was on product innovation, World Cup expectations, and general rugby culture. Among the attending athletes was Will Jordan, who went on to become the tournament’s top try-scorer with 8 tries, even as the All Blacks narrowly lost the final to South Africa.

3 Key Learnings:

  • Organization: Trusting your partners and ensuring early coordination is essential—especially when high-profile athletes are involved.
  • Creative Freedom: Influencers and creators bring their own unique ideas; they know which formats truly resonate with their audience.
  • Fan Culture: Creating authentic moments where fans can connect with their idols provides immense long-term brand value.
